2001 Isuzu Axiom vs. 1979 Toyota Corolla

To start off, 2001 Isuzu Axiom is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1979 Toyota Corolla.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1979 Toyota Corolla would be higher. At 3,494 cc (6 cylinders), 2001 Isuzu Axiom is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2001 Isuzu Axiom (212 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 144 more horse power than 1979 Toyota Corolla. (68 HP @ 5600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2001 Isuzu Axiom should accelerate faster than 1979 Toyota Corolla.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2001 Isuzu Axiom weights approximately 1015 kg more than 1979 Toyota Corolla.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2001 Isuzu Axiom is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1979 Toyota Corolla.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2001 Isuzu Axiom will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2001 Isuzu Axiom (312 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 207 more torque (in Nm) than 1979 Toyota Corolla. (105 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2001 Isuzu Axiom will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1979 Toyota Corolla.
